Introduction to Cab Side Steps
Cab side steps, also known as truck step bars or running boards, are essential accessories for pickup trucks and larger vehicles. They enhance accessibility, improve safety, and add a stylish look to your vehicle. Types of Cab Side Steps
Running Boards
Running boards are wider and often offer more surface area than traditional side steps. They provide a stable base and often feature a non-slip surface. Running boards are ideal for families or anyone who prioritizes accessibility and safety.
Step Bars
Step bars are typically narrower and feature a streamlined design. They come in various styles, including oval, round, and square shapes. Step bars are great for those who want a basic, minimalistic look while still maintaining functionality.
Custom-Fit Side Steps
Many manufacturers offer custom-fit side steps designed specifically for certain makes and models. These options ensure an easy installation process and a perfect fit, enhancing both functionality and style.
How to Choose the Right Cab Side Step
When selecting the best cab side step for your vehicle, consider the following factors:
Material
Choose a material that suits your environment and personal preference. Stainless steel is durable and resistant to rust, while aluminum is lightweight and easy to install. Plastic options are often more affordable but may not offer the same longevity.
Weight Capacity
Check the weight capacity of the side steps to ensure they can support the needs of all users, especially in families or commercial settings where heavier loads might be involved.
Installation Process
Consider whether you’ll be installing the side steps yourself or having them professionally installed. Many products come with easy-to-follow instructions, making DIY installation a viable option.
